My wife and I volunteer at the local dive shop helping teach kids how to snorkle and take UW pictures. I tried a pair of full foot scubapro twin jets and absolutely fell in love with them. I bought a pair of open heel and won't use any othe fin for my diving style. I don't generally promote a certain style or brand of gear but I like these. I have tried a couple of other styles of split fins but these work best for me. They are light, flexible and don't hurt my ankles.
